comparison src/Makefile @ 697:f08390485cd3 v7.0210

updated for version 7.0210
author vimboss
date Wed, 01 Mar 2006 00:01:28 +0000
parents a28f83d37113
children 335444c09581
comparison
equal deleted inserted replaced
696:f0a9ef4db025 697:f08390485cd3
1267 1267
1268 PRE_DEFS = -Iproto $(DEFS) $(GUI_DEFS) $(GUI_IPATH) $(CPPFLAGS) $(EXTRA_IPATHS) 1268 PRE_DEFS = -Iproto $(DEFS) $(GUI_DEFS) $(GUI_IPATH) $(CPPFLAGS) $(EXTRA_IPATHS)
1269 POST_DEFS = $(X_CFLAGS) $(MZSCHEME_CFLAGS) $(PERL_CFLAGS) $(PYTHON_CFLAGS) $(TCL_CFLAGS) $(RUBY_CFLAGS) $(EXTRA_DEFS) 1269 POST_DEFS = $(X_CFLAGS) $(MZSCHEME_CFLAGS) $(PERL_CFLAGS) $(PYTHON_CFLAGS) $(TCL_CFLAGS) $(RUBY_CFLAGS) $(EXTRA_DEFS)
1270 1270
1271 ALL_CFLAGS = $(PRE_DEFS) $(CFLAGS) $(PROFILE_CFLAGS) $(POST_DEFS) 1271 ALL_CFLAGS = $(PRE_DEFS) $(CFLAGS) $(PROFILE_CFLAGS) $(POST_DEFS)
1272
1273 # Exclude $CFLAGS for osdef.sh, for Mac 10.4 some flags don't work together
1274 # with "-E".
1275 OSDEF_CFLAGS = $(PRE_DEFS) $(POST_DEFS)
1272 1276
1273 LINT_CFLAGS = -DLINT -I. $(PRE_DEFS) $(POST_DEFS) -Dinline= -D__extension__= -Dalloca=alloca 1277 LINT_CFLAGS = -DLINT -I. $(PRE_DEFS) $(POST_DEFS) -Dinline= -D__extension__= -Dalloca=alloca
1274 1278
1275 LINT_EXTRA = -DUSE_SNIFF -DHANGUL_INPUT -D"__attribute__(x)=" 1279 LINT_EXTRA = -DUSE_SNIFF -DHANGUL_INPUT -D"__attribute__(x)="
1276 1280
2217 $(PERL) -e 'unless ( $$] >= 5.005 ) { for (qw(na defgv errgv)) { print "#define PL_$$_ $$_\n" }}' > $@ 2221 $(PERL) -e 'unless ( $$] >= 5.005 ) { for (qw(na defgv errgv)) { print "#define PL_$$_ $$_\n" }}' > $@
2218 $(PERL) $(PERLLIB)/ExtUtils/xsubpp -prototypes -typemap \ 2222 $(PERL) $(PERLLIB)/ExtUtils/xsubpp -prototypes -typemap \
2219 $(PERLLIB)/ExtUtils/typemap if_perl.xs >> $@ 2223 $(PERLLIB)/ExtUtils/typemap if_perl.xs >> $@
2220 2224
2221 auto/osdef.h: auto/config.h osdef.sh osdef1.h.in osdef2.h.in 2225 auto/osdef.h: auto/config.h osdef.sh osdef1.h.in osdef2.h.in
2222 CC="$(CC) $(ALL_CFLAGS)" srcdir=$(srcdir) sh $(srcdir)/osdef.sh 2226 CC="$(CC) $(OSDEF_CFLAGS)" srcdir=$(srcdir) sh $(srcdir)/osdef.sh
2223 2227
2224 QUOTESED = sed -e 's/"/\\"/g' -e 's/\\"/"/' -e 's/\\";$$/";/' 2228 QUOTESED = sed -e 's/"/\\"/g' -e 's/\\"/"/' -e 's/\\";$$/";/'
2225 auto/pathdef.c: Makefile auto/config.mk 2229 auto/pathdef.c: Makefile auto/config.mk
2226 -@echo creating $@ 2230 -@echo creating $@
2227 -@echo '/* pathdef.c */' > $@ 2231 -@echo '/* pathdef.c */' > $@